Ombre Hair 101: A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1: Prepare Your Hair

Before attempting ombre, it's essential to ensure your hair is in the best possible condition. This means getting regular trims, using quality hair care products, and avoiding heat styling tools that can damage your locks.

Step 2: Choose Your Colors

The ombre effect is all about creating a seamless gradient of colors. When selecting your colors, consider a combination of shades that complement each other and flatter your skin tone.

Step 3: Lighten Your Hair

Lightening your hair is the first step in achieving the ombre effect. This can be done using a bleach or high-lift dye, depending on your desired level of lightness.

Step 4: Apply the Darker Shade

Using a balayage or freehand painting technique, apply the darker shade of hair color to the ends of your hair.

Step 5: Blend the Colors

Using a tint brush or an ombre brush, blend the colors together to create a seamless gradient effect. This is the most crucial step in achieving the perfect ombre look.
